Принцип разделения данных на пакеты – ключевой фактор успешной передачи информации — главные преимущества, основные принципы и методы обеспечения эффективности передачи

Разделение данных на пакеты является одним из основных принципов передачи информации в компьютерных сетях. Этот принцип позволяет обеспечить эффективность, надежность и безопасность передачи данных. Концепция разделения данных на пакеты основана на том, что передаваемая информация разбивается на более мелкие единицы, называемые пакетами, которые передаются по сети и затем собираются в исходное сообщение на принимающей стороне.

Одним из главных преимуществ разделения данных на пакеты является возможность передачи больших объемов информации. Разбиение данных на пакеты позволяет передавать информацию в виде отдельных блоков, что упрощает процесс передачи и уменьшает вероятность потери данных при передаче. Кроме того, разделение данных на пакеты позволяет достичь более высокой скорости передачи данных, поскольку пакеты могут передаваться параллельно различными путями по сети.

Принцип разделения данных на пакеты основывается на нескольких ключевых идеях. Во-первых, каждый пакет содержит не только данные, но и информацию о маршруте, который необходимо пройти для доставки пакета. Эта информация помогает маршрутизаторам направлять пакеты по сети оптимальным образом. Во-вторых, пакеты независимы друг от друга и могут передаваться разными путями через сеть. Это повышает надежность передачи данных, так как, в случае возникновения ошибки на одном из путей, остальные пакеты могут быть доставлены успешно. И, наконец, каждый пакет содержит контрольную сумму, которая позволяет проверить целостность данных и обнаружить ошибки в процессе передачи.

Преимущества разделения данных на пакеты

1. Улучшение производительности: Разделение данных на пакеты позволяет передавать информацию параллельно, что увеличивает скорость передачи и снижает задержки. Кроме того, если один пакет данных идет в пути сети медленнее, это не замедлит передачу остальных пакетов.

2. Обеспечение целостности данных: Каждый пакет данных содержит информацию о своем порядке и проверочные суммы, которые позволяют проверить, была ли передача данных успешной и не произошло ли искажение информации. Если при передаче данные повреждаются, получатель может запросить повторную передачу только поврежденных пакетов, минимизируя потерю целостности.

3. Увеличение надежности: Разделение данных на пакеты позволяет избежать проблем, связанных с передачей больших объемов данных целиком. Если передача прерывается, отправитель может продолжить передачу с того места, где она была прервана, без необходимости начинать передачу с самого начала.

4. Универсальность и масштабируемость: Разделение данных на пакеты делает передачу информации независимой от типа и особенностей сети. Это позволяет использовать одинаковый протокол передачи данных в различных сетевых окружениях, что делает систему более масштабируемой и удобной для использования.

5. Улучшение безопасности: Разделение данных на пакеты позволяет обеспечить конфиденциальность информации, так как пакеты могут быть зашифрованы и передаваться отдельно. Это обеспечивает защиту данных от несанкционированного доступа и возможность контролировать доступ к информации.

В целом, разделение данных на пакеты при передаче является важным и полезным механизмом, который позволяет обеспечить эффективность, надежность и безопасность передачи информации в компьютерных сетях. Он является основой для работы сетевых протоколов и позволяет нам пользоваться множеством возможностей, которые предоставляют современные сети.

Эффективность передачи данных

  1. Увеличение пропускной способности сети. Пакетная передача данных позволяет одновременно передавать несколько пакетов, что увеличивает скорость и производительность сети. Большие объемы данных могут быть разделены на небольшие блоки, которые передаются параллельно по разным каналам.
  2. Повышение надежности передачи. Если один пакет данных повреждается или теряется в процессе передачи, то остальные пакеты могут быть успешно доставлены. Каждый пакет содержит информацию о своем порядке и целостности, что позволяет восстановить исходные данные без необходимости повторной передачи всего блока информации.
  3. Поддержка многоадресной передачи. Разделение данных на пакеты позволяет эффективно передавать информацию на несколько устройств одновременно. Выделение отдельных пакетов для каждого получателя позволяет снизить нагрузку на сеть и обеспечить доставку данных только тем устройствам, которые их нуждаются.
  4. Легкая масштабируемость. Пакетная передача данных обеспечивает возможность легкого расширения и изменения сетевой инфраструктуры. Новые устройства или сетевые компоненты могут быть просто добавлены или заменены без значительного влияния на работу сети в целом.

Разделение данных на пакеты при передаче обеспечивает эффективность, надежность и гибкость в обмене информацией между устройствами. Он является основополагающим принципом работы сетей и позволяет обеспечить высокую производительность передачи данных.

Устойчивость к помехам

Однако, если данные разделены на пакеты, то возможные помехи будут влиять на каждый пакет отдельно. В случае потери пакета, протокол передачи данных может повторно отправить только этот пакет, а не все данные сначала. Это позволяет увеличить надежность передачи и снизить вероятность потери данных.

Кроме того, разделение данных на пакеты также позволяет более эффективно использовать доступную пропускную способность сети. Если все данные передавались бы единым блоком, то при возникновении помехи или потери пакета, вся передача была бы приостановлена до полного восстановления сигнала. При разделении данных на пакеты, можно продолжать передачу остальных пакетов, что позволяет более эффективно использовать пропускную способность канала передачи.

Таким образом, устойчивость к помехам является важной особенностью разделения данных на пакеты при передаче, которая обеспечивает более надежную и эффективную передачу информации в сети.

Повышение скорости обработки

Пакеты данных могут передаваться по разным каналам связи и обрабатываться параллельно, что позволяет значительно ускорить процесс передачи и обработки информации. Такая система позволяет распределить нагрузку и использовать ресурсы более эффективно.

При разделении данных на пакеты, каждый пакет содержит информацию о своем порядке следования, что позволяет получателю корректно и быстро собрать и обработать данные в правильной последовательности. Благодаря этому, время, необходимое для передачи и обработки информации сокращается, что в свою очередь позволяет достичь более высокой скорости обработки данных.

Таким образом, разделение данных на пакеты при передаче является эффективным способом повышения скорости обработки информации. Он позволяет максимально эффективно использовать каналы связи и распределить нагрузку на обработку данных. Это особенно важно в случаях, когда требуется передать большой объем информации или обрабатывать данные в реальном времени.

Оптимизация использования ресурсов сети

Разделение данных на пакеты при передаче имеет ряд преимуществ, среди которых оптимизация использования ресурсов сети. Этот принцип основывается на разбиении информации на отдельные фрагменты и передаче их по сети поочередно.

Эта техника позволяет эффективно использовать пропускную способность сети. Вместо передачи большого файла целиком, данные разделяются на маленькие пакеты, которые отправляются по отдельности. Таким образом, возможно использование доступного пространства канала более эффективно. К тому же, разделение данных на пакеты позволяет более эффективно использовать маршрутизацию, так как каждый пакет может выбрать свой путь до назначения.

Оптимизация использования ресурсов сети также позволяет обеспечить более надежную передачу данных. Если в процессе передачи один из пакетов был потерян или поврежден, то получатель может запросить повторную отправку только этого пакета, вместо полной передачи всего файла. Это снижает объем передаваемых данных и экономит ресурсы сети.

Таким образом, разделение данных на пакеты при передаче помогает оптимизировать использование ресурсов сети, повышает эффективность передачи данных и обеспечивает более надежную связь между отправителем и получателем.

Улучшение масштабируемости системы

Преимущества разделения данных на пакеты очевидны. Во-первых, оно позволяет разделить объем информации на более мелкие порции, что упрощает ее обработку и передачу. Кроме того, разделение данных на пакеты повышает надежность передачи, так как в случае потери или повреждения одного пакета, остальные пакеты всё равно будут доставлены и собраны в нужной последовательности.

Масштабируемость системы – это ее способность эффективно управлять растущим объемом информации и количеством пользователей. Использование разделения данных на пакеты помогает достичь этой цели. Пакетная передача позволяет распределить нагрузку на сеть, обеспечивая более равномерную загрузку серверов и линий связи.

Кроме того, разделение данных на пакеты упрощает обновление и модернизацию системы. При необходимости можно заменять или расширять отдельные компоненты системы, не влияя на работу остальных компонентов. Это позволяет гибко адаптировать систему к меняющимся требованиям и улучшить ее производительность.

В целом, разделение данных на пакеты при передаче является эффективным и надежным способом улучшить масштабируемость системы.

Обеспечение безопасности данных

При передаче данных по сети важно обеспечить их безопасность. Разделение данных на пакеты играет значительную роль в этом процессе.

Основной принцип, лежащий в основе безопасности данных, заключается в разделении информации на мелкие единицы — пакеты. Каждый пакет содержит определенный объем данных и дополнительную информацию, необходимую для их передачи.

Этот подход позволяет улучшить безопасность данных по нескольким причинам. Во-первых, разделение данных на пакеты делает их передачу более надежной. Если один из пакетов потеряется или будет поврежден в процессе передачи, остальные пакеты все равно доставятся получателю. Это также позволяет обнаружить ошибки в передаче данных и восстановить поврежденные пакеты.

Во-вторых, разделение данных на пакеты обеспечивает конфиденциальность информации. Пакеты могут быть зашифрованы, что делает их непригодными для чтения без ключа. Это позволяет защитить данные от несанкционированного доступа или перехвата в процессе передачи по сети.

И, наконец, разделение данных на пакеты позволяет обеспечить целостность информации. Каждый пакет содержит дополнительную информацию о целостности данных, такую как контрольные суммы или хэш-значения. Получатель может проверить эти значения и убедиться, что данные не были изменены в процессе передачи.

Таким образом, разделение данных на пакеты является одним из основных принципов обеспечения безопасности при передаче данных по сети. Этот подход позволяет улучшить надежность, конфиденциальность и целостность информации в процессе ее передачи.

Принципы разделения данных на пакеты

Принципы разделения данных на пакеты включают:

1. СегментацияИсходные данные разбиваются на более мелкие блоки — пакеты, что позволяет передавать их по сети по частям. Это особенно важно при передаче больших файлов, таких как изображения или видео, где вся информация может не поместиться в один пакет.
2. НумерацияКаждый пакет получает уникальный номер для идентификации. Это позволяет приемнику правильно собрать и восстановить исходные данные по порядку при получении.
3. ЗаголовкиКаждый пакет содержит заголовок, который включает информацию о размере пакета, адресе отправителя, адресе получателя и других параметрах, необходимых для правильной передачи и обработки данных.
4. Проверка целостностиКаждый пакет содержит проверочную сумму, которая вычисляется на основе его содержимого. Это позволяет контрольной сумме приемнику проверить целостность данных и обнаружить возможные ошибки при передаче.
5. ПереотправкаПри возникновении ошибок при передаче пакеты могут быть переотправлены, чтобы гарантировать доставку информации в целостности. Приемник может запросить повторную отправку неправильных или потерянных пакетов, чтобы восстановить полные данные.

Правильное разделение данных на пакеты и их последующая передача в соответствии с принципами позволяет обеспечить надежную и эффективную передачу информации по сети, минимизируя возможные ошибки и улучшая производительность передачи данных.

Оцените статью